visualizer: update PCM device id for sdm660 target

Update PCM device id for sdm660 target.

Change-Id: Icc27d5319ac3273c34f1c32d8fcbbd4b57255fda
CRs-Fixed: 2032490
diff --git a/visualizer/Android.mk b/visualizer/Android.mk
index bc44139..622af33 100644
--- a/visualizer/Android.mk
+++ b/visualizer/Android.mk
@@ -21,8 +21,8 @@
 
 LOCAL_CFLAGS+= -O2 -fvisibility=hidden
 
-ifneq ($(filter msm8998,$(TARGET_BOARD_PLATFORM)),)
-    LOCAL_CFLAGS += -DPLATFORM_MSM8998
+ifneq ($(filter sdm660 msm8998,$(TARGET_BOARD_PLATFORM)),)
+    LOCAL_CFLAGS += -DCAPTURE_DEVICE=7
 endif
 
 LOCAL_SHARED_LIBRARIES := \
diff --git a/visualizer/offload_visualizer.c b/visualizer/offload_visualizer.c
index 716755b..8d06b8d 100644
--- a/visualizer/offload_visualizer.c
+++ b/visualizer/offload_visualizer.c
@@ -1,5 +1,5 @@
 /*
- * Copyright (C) 2013 The Android Open Source Project
+ * Copyright (C) 2013, 2017 The Android Open Source Project
  *
  * Licensed under the Apache License, Version 2.0 (the "License");
  * you may not use this file except in compliance with the License.
@@ -179,9 +179,8 @@
 
 #define MIXER_CARD 0
 #define SOUND_CARD 0
-#ifdef PLATFORM_MSM8998
-#define CAPTURE_DEVICE 7
-#else
+
+#ifndef CAPTURE_DEVICE
 #define CAPTURE_DEVICE 8
 #endif